About Cerebral Palsy
Although it is often referred to as one condition, cerebral palsy is actually an umbrella term for several different but closely related disorders. All of them involve damage to the brain, most often affecting the neurons that allow the cerebral cortex to communicate with the cerebellum. The cortex is the center of thought and memory, while the cerebellum controls balance and muscle coordination.
It is often difficult to determine the cause of an individual case of cerebral palsy. This is because it can be caused by so many different things, including:
- Pre-term birth
- Lack of oxygen for the child during a difficult birth
- Brain injuries caused by negligent OB-GYN workers
- Infection during pregnancy or shortly after birth
- The mother's alcohol or drug use during pregnancy
